Power Meets Style – The Bespoke Jet™ Has Landed in Malaysia

March 15, 2022 by StrawberrY Gal

 Samsung Malaysia Electronics today announces the arrival of the Bespoke Jet™ in Malaysia, a cordless stick vacuum with an all-in-one Clean Station™ that delivers hygienic cleaning performance with a 99.999% multi-layered filtration system . Packed with innovation, the Bespoke Jet™ also earned recognition as an honouree at the CES Innovation Awards 2021. 

“We were thrilled when we announced the expansion of the Samsung Bespoke line with the Bespoke Jet™ at CES 2022 in January,” said Edward Han, President of Samsung Malaysia Electronics. “Cleanliness and good hygiene have never been more imperative and a vacuum cleaner is an essential tool for any household to perform their cleaning routine. The Bespoke Jet™ is a perfect embodiment of the Samsung Bespoke brand and now, Malaysians are able to experience a device that not only is powerful but could also fit seamlessly with the interior design of their homes.”

Hygienic Cleaning Performance

The Bespoke Jet™ features the all-in-one Clean Station™ that keeps the homeowner’s space hygienic while cleaning. When docked, you don’t have to worry about getting your hands dirty and rely on the Clean Station™ to do all the dirty work for you. It automatically and effectively empties the dust bin minus the emission of fine dust back into your environment thanks to Samsung’s Air Pulse technology. The dock also automatically charges the stick vacuum the moment you dock it. 

The 99.999% Multi Filtration System ensure that clean air is released as it traps 99.999% of fine dust  while the anti-bacterial dust bag inhibits 99.99% of bacterial growth . The main cyclone and mesh grille filter traps larger dust particles, the jet cyclone and micro filter catch fine dust while the fine dust filter prevents the emission of micro-dust  into the air. The best part is that the dust bin and multi-cyclone system is fully washable, giving you extra peace of mind for a thorough clean after using it. 

Lightweight and Convenient Design 

This cordless stick vacuum is equipped with the Digital Inverter Motor that has been improved from its predecessor to deliver better cleaning performance. It’s 47% lighter , rotates at 135,000rpm, delivering an input power of 580W  and suction power up to 210W . 

It weighs 1.44kg which makes cleaning routine less tiring and easier to manoeuvre around the nooks and crannies of your home. The Bespoke Jet™ also comes with a powerful battery that maintains suction up to an hour – which can be easily replaced with a spare battery  if you need longer cleaning time. Samsung’s unique technology also ensures that the performance of your vacuum retains at 70% even after 500 cycles .

The Bespoke Jet™ comes with an LCD Digital Display that supports 28 languages . This display provides you all the information you need from suction level settings and running time as well as error messages – like clogging, missing filters etc. – and solutions to fix the issue. 

Powerful and Effortless Cleaning Experience 

Newly upgraded brush attachments are also introduced to accompany your stylish Bespoke Jet™. To help you further clean your floors, the stick vacuum also comes with a Spray Spinning Sweeper that features dual spinning wet pads that rotate up to 100 minutes . It also comes with a 150ml water tank so you can manually spray more for a longer cleaning experience. 

For powerful cleaning, the Jet Dual brush features a combination of nylon and rubber bristle to improve the carpet cleaning experience, especially as it rotates at 4,000rpm . The Jet Dual brush’s soft roller can also be used on hard floors to pick up large dust . The new Slim Action brush is now slimmer and 100g lighter, making it easier and more comfortable to conveniently clean around furniture even when space is limited between items.


Price and Availability

The Bespoke Jet™ comes in three stylish colours – Midnight Blue, Misty White and Woody Green – at a recommended retail price of RM3,899. At the moment, consumers in Malaysia will be able to buy the Bespoke Jet premium in Midnight Blue that comes with the Slim Action brush attachment, Spray Spinning Sweeper attachment and other accessories. 

From 14th March 2022 to 30th April 2022, not only will you get to purchase the Bespoke Jet™ at only RM3,699, you will also receive the Galaxy Buds Live (SM-R180NZKAXME) worth RM549  for free.
